Hawks Win at Oral Roberts in Four Sets

UND had four players with six or more kills, led by Paige Barber with a match-high 15.

TULSA, Okla. – The North Dakota volleyball team picked up a road victory over Oral Roberts (25-21, 19-25, 25-20, 25-19) on Thursday evening from Mabee Arena. NoDak improves to 7-15 and 4-7 in conference play, while Oral Roberts falls to 2-21 and 0-11 in Summit League play.

The match featured 24 ties and 12 lead changes, as the Hawks picked up their first road win of the season, winning set one, dropping set two and taking sets three and four.

UND had a balanced attack offensively, having four players register six or more kills. Paige Barber had a match-high 15 kills, followed by eight from Matthea Dalton, seven from Katy Riviere and six from Ava Galvan.

Defensively, Izzie McCormick had a team-high 15 digs, followed by 12 digs from Sadie White and 10 digs from Barber. White contributed 31 assists, good for her sixth double-double of the season and Barber earned her third double-double of the year.

Five Hawks had two or more blocks, in Vanessa Washington (4), Galvan (3), Riviere (3), White (3) and Kimanni Rugley (2).

North Dakota fell behind in set one by as many as six, trailing 11-5 then 13-8. Down 13-8, UND flipped momentum completely, going on a 9-1 run to take a 17-14 advantage. From there the Fighting Hawks continued their strong play, finding themselves up 22-21, scoring three straight points to end the set, taking the frame 25-21.

The Hawks only held 1-0 and 2-1 leads in set two, but neither team led by more than two through the first 34 points of the set, with Oral Roberts leading 18-16. The Golden Eagles created some separation from that point, closing the set on a 7-3 run to win 25-19.

Set three was another highly competitive frame, with the Hawks finding themselves down 14-11. With their back against the walls, the Fighting Hawks used a 7-0 run, featured by two kills from Riviere, one from Rugley and one from Dalton to take an 18-14 lead. NoDak led by as many as six, taking set three, 25-20.

The fourth set was close for the first 19 points of the frame, with North Dakota clinging to a 10-9 lead. An 8-2 burst from the Hawks created separation, going up 18-11. North Dakota did not look back, ending the match off a Barber kill, assisted by Reagan McIntosh to take set four, 25-19.
